(AJG)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$4.47, narrowly missing the consensus estimate of $4.472 by $0.04. Revenue figures were not disclosed. The stock declined 0.76% in aftermarket trading, reflecting a muted reaction to the modest earnings miss.

Gallagherâs core brokerage and risk management segments continued to demonstrate resilience in the first quarter. The companyâs organic commission growth likely benefited from favorable insurance market conditions, including firming pricing in property/casualty lines and steady demand for specialty coverages. Segment-specific performance details were not provided, but Gallagherâs diversified product mixâincluding employee benefits, wholesale brokerage, and reinsuranceâmay have supported overall revenue stability. Operating margins could have faced headwinds from higher personnel-related costs and ongoing investments in digital tools and data analytics. The reported EPS of $4.47, while slightly below expectations, was broadly in line with the companyâs historical trend of consistent earnings. Gallagherâs strong balance sheet and track record of strategic acquisitions have historically provided a buffer against cyclical pressures. However, the exact impact of interest rates and claims inflation on underwriting margins remains a variable to monitor. The companyâs ability to cross-sell services across its client base may continue to drive modest growth in account retention and new business.

However, the company may continue to benefit from a hard market in commercial insurance, which could support further organic growth. Strategic priorities are expected to include expanding niche specialty offerings, particularly in environmental, cyber, and M&A-related coverages. Technology investmentsâaimed at streamlining brokerage operations and enhancing client digital experiencesâmay remain a focus area. Risk factors that could temper performance include macroeconomic uncertainty, potential moderation in insurance pricing, and competitive pressure from both traditional brokers and insurtech entrants. Additionally, lower realized investment income or higher loss costs in the underwriting portfolio could pressure earnings. Gallagherâs disciplined approach to acquisitions suggests that bolt-on deals with mid-sized firms may continue to supplement organic growth, though integration risks persist. The companyâs global footprint may provide some diversification against regional economic downturns, but currency fluctuations could create headwinds for international revenue.

The 0.76% decline in AJGâs stock following the earnings release suggests that investors viewed the slight EPS miss as largely immaterial, particularly given the underlying strength of the business. Analysts may focus on organic growth trends and margin stability rather than the precise earnings beat/miss. Some investment implications include the durability of Gallagherâs competitive moat in a fragmented market and its capacity to maintain mid-single-digit organic growth. Key items to watch in upcoming quarters include the pace of commission revenue expansion, cost control measures, and any commentary on acquisition pipeline activity. The companyâs disciplined capital allocationâhistorically involving both share repurchases and dividend increasesâcould support long-term shareholder returns. However, rising expenses and potential regulatory changes in insurance distribution remain risks.
